What Does BITTF Do?

Bitterroot Resources Ltd. was incorporated in 1951 and is headquartered in West Vancouver, Canada. The company is an exploration stage entity that engages in the acquisition, development, exploration, and evaluation of mineral properties, primarily in the United States. Bitterroot focuses on exploring for valuable mineral deposits, including copper, nickel, gold, silver, and platinum group metals (PGMs). The company currently holds a 100% interest in the LM property, which spans 40 acres in Baraga County, Michigan. Additionally, Bitterroot has an option to acquire a 100% interest in the Castle West property, which consists of 34 unpatented mining claims and three leased unpatented claims, covering approximately 282 hectares located in the Gilbert mining district of western Nevada. Furthermore, the company holds 13 claims in the Coyote Sinter gold/silver project situated in Elko County, Nevada. F-Score 2/9Financial Health

Bitterroot Resources Ltd.'s Piotroski F-Score is 2/9, a 9-point checklist of profitability, leverage and efficiency — flagging fundamental weakness worth scrutiny. Its Altman Z-Score of -4.06 places it in the distress zone, a signal of elevated financial risk.

ROE -6%Key Financial Metrics

Return on equity for Bitterroot Resources Ltd. stands at -5.9%, a gauge of how efficiently it converts shareholder capital into profit. Return on assets is -4.9%, showing how much profit it generates from its asset base. Its free cash flow yield is -14.1%, a gauge of the cash the business throws off relative to its market value. A current ratio of 0.11 means current liabilities exceed short-term assets, a liquidity point worth watching. Its earnings yield is -7.1%, the inverse of the P/E and a quick read on earnings relative to price.

BITTF OTC Market Information

The OTC Other tier represents securities that do not meet the requirements for higher tiers like OTCQX or OTCQB. This tier includes companies that may have limited disclosure and trading activity, making them more speculative in nature compared to stocks listed on major exchanges like NYSE or NASDAQ.

  • OTC Tier: OTC Other
Liquidity: Bitterroot Resources Ltd. may experience lower trading volumes, leading to wider bid-ask spreads and potentially higher trading costs. Investors should be aware of the liquidity challenges associated with OTC stocks, which can affect the ease of buying and selling shares.
OTC Risk Factors:
  • Limited financial reporting and transparency compared to larger exchanges.
  • Higher volatility and price fluctuations due to lower trading volumes.
  • Potential for less investor protection and regulatory oversight.
  • Increased risk of fraud or misleading information in the OTC market.
